Broadway East is a black (non-hispanic) neighborhood in Baltimore with 3 census tracts and a population of 3,406 residents. The neighborhood's pop-weighted eviction-risk score of 7.3/10 (Elevated tier) blends state law, county-level filing rates, parent-city politics, and tract-specific rent-to-income ratios + poverty. 61% of renters here pay at least 30% of household income on rent, and 39% are severely cost-burdened (≥50% of income). Average gross rent of $1,262/month sits 5% lower than the Baltimore citywide average ($1,331).

Eviction-adjacent indicators in Broadway East
Average across all constituent tracts, population-weighted. Source: CDC PLACES (cwsq-ngmh) crude prevalence.
32.6%Housing insecurity
24.5%Utility shutoff threat
40.7%Food insecurity
43.8%SNAP enrollment
12.0%No health insurance
41.6%Any disability
